Effect of dietary beta-agonist treatment, vitamin D_3 supplementation and electrical stimulation of carcasses on colour and drip loss of steaks from feedlot steers

摘要

In this study, 20 young steers received no beta-agonist (C) and 100 animals all received zilpaterol hydrochloride (Z), with 1 group receiving Z while the other 4 groups receiving Z and vitamin D_3 at the following levels (IU/animal/day) and durations before slaughter: 7 million for 3 days (3D7M) or 6 days (6D7M), 7 million for 6 days with 7 days no supplementation (6D7M7N) and 1 million for 9 days (9D1M). Left carcass sides were electrically stimulated (ES) and right sides not (NES). Samples were analysed fresh or vacuum-aged for 14 days post mortem. Parameters included drip loss and instrumental colour measurements. In general, zilpaterol showed increased drip loss, lighter meat, and reduced redness. Vitamin D_3 supplementation could not consistently overcome these negative effects. All vitamin D_3 treatments reduced drip loss of stimulated aged steaks.
